About the role
- User support and troubleshooting: Assist with IT issues; diagnose and resolve hardware and software problems.
- Installation and configuration: Install and configure PCs, laptops, printers; set up user accounts and software updates.
- Network management: Manage and monitor networks; support LANs, WANs, and VPNs; perform network troubleshooting.
- Data backup and recovery: Perform regular data backups, maintain disaster recovery plans, and execute data restoration.
- Security management: Implement security measures, manage antivirus software and firewalls, and provide IT security training.
- Documentation and reporting: Document IT processes, produce reports, and maintain a knowledge base.
- Training and development: Conduct employee training on new technologies and IT systems.
- Hardware maintenance and repair: Maintain and repair hardware, monitor infrastructure, and manage warranty claims.
- Project support: Contribute to IT projects, collaborate with other departments, and support IT initiatives.
- Helpdesk management: Manage helpdesk tickets, prioritize and escalate support requests, and ensure prompt resolution.
